Saudi Arabia
Saudi Arabia, a land of fascinating contrasts and deep-rooted traditions, lies on the edge of the Arabian desert. Known as the cradle of Islam and home to the holy cities of Mecca and Medina, Saudi Arabia combines a rich religious and cultural history with dynamic modernity.
From Riyadh's modern skyline to the historic desert oases of Al-Ula and the stunning coastline of the Red Sea, the country offers a remarkably diverse experience. The majestic sand dunes of the Rub' al-Khali, the ancient ruins of Diriyah, and the bustling metropolises with luxury shopping centers and impressive architectural projects are just a few of Saudi Arabia's highlights.
